District-Level NCES Analysis
Winfree Academy Charter Schools operates 6 public schools serving 1,153 students, placing it among the smallest districts in Texas. The school portfolio breaks down into 6 high schools, a small enough portfolio that most families will interact with nearly every campus in the district at some point. These enrollment and school figures come from the NCES Common Core of Data (CCD) 2024-25 release, and the district is based in Dallas County.
Per-pupil expenditure runs $9,172 according to the NCES F-33 School District Finance Survey, among the bottom 121 of 1202 Texas districts by per-pupil spending. See how Texas compares in our national per-pupil spending analysis. The funding mix is 2.1% local, 79.6% state, and 18.3% federal, a state-revenue-heavy mix that insulates the district somewhat from local property-tax volatility, though it ties funding to state budget cycles. The district's equity score is 24/100, ranked #931 of 1044 in Texas against a state average of 50, notably less even than the typical district in the state for how evenly funding reaches its schools.

Demographically, the student body averages 56.1% Hispanic or Latino, 23.9% African American, 14.9% White across the district's schools. Its most demographically mixed campus is Winfree Academy Charter School (Richardson), with a diversity index of 64.5/100.
Winfree Academy Charter School Dallas accounts for 21.2% of all Winfree Academy Charter Schools student enrollment
